教學簡介
此單元假設您已安裝 Recoil 和 React。請參閱入門頁面,了解如何從頭開始使用 Recoil 和 React。以下各單元中的元件都假設父層樹狀結構中含有 <RecoilRoot />
。
在本教學中,我們將建立一個簡單的待辦事項應用程式。我們的應用程式將能夠執行以下操作
- 新增待辦事項
- 編輯待辦事項
- 刪除待辦事項
- 篩選待辦事項
- 顯示實用的統計資料
在此過程中,我們將涵蓋原子、選取器、原子家族以及 Recoil API 提供的鉤子。
SideGuide 提供了此教學互動版本,內含即時程式碼範例:https://app.sideguide.dev/recoil/tutorial/